arrow_back

透過 Vertex AI Gemini API 採取保護措施

登录 加入
Test and share your knowledge with our community!
done
Get access to over 700 hands-on labs, skill badges, and courses

透過 Vertex AI Gemini API 採取保護措施

Lab 1 小时 30 分钟 universal_currency_alt 1 积分 show_chart 中级
Test and share your knowledge with our community!
done
Get access to over 700 hands-on labs, skill badges, and courses

總覽

本研究室說明如何檢查 Vertex AI Gemini API 回傳的安全評分,以及如何設定安全門檻來篩選回應。

學習目標

  1. 呼叫 Vertex AI Gemini API,並檢查回應的安全評分
  2. 定義門檻,按需求篩選安全評分

工作 0:設定和需求

在每個研究室中,您都能在固定時間內免付費建立新的 Google Cloud 專案,並使用一組資源。

  1. 請透過無痕式視窗登入 Qwiklabs。

  2. 請記下研究室的存取時間 (例如 1:15:00),並確保自己能在時間限制內完成作業。
    研究室不提供暫停功能。如有需要,您可以重新開始,但原先的進度恕無法保留。

  3. 準備就緒後,請按一下「Start lab」

  4. 請記下研究室憑證 (使用者名稱密碼),這組資訊將用於登入 Google Cloud 控制台。

  5. 按一下「Open Google Console」

  6. 按一下「Use another account」,然後複製這個研究室的憑證,並貼入提示訊息。
    如果使用其他憑證,系統會顯示錯誤或向您收取費用

  7. 接受條款,然後略過資源復原頁面。

啟用 Notebooks API

  1. 前往 Google Cloud 控制台,依序點選「導覽選單」>「API 和服務」>「程式庫」

  2. 搜尋「Notebooks API」並按下 Enter 鍵。

  3. 點選搜尋結果中的「Notebooks API」;若尚未啟用 API,請點選「啟用」

啟用 Vertex AI API

  1. 前往 Google Cloud 控制台,依序點選「導覽選單」>「Vertex AI」>「資訊主頁」

  2. 點選「啟用所有建議的 API」

點選「Check my progress」確認目標已達成。 啟用 Notebooks API 和 Vertex AI API

工作 1:開啟 Vertex AI Workbench 執行個體

  1. 前往 Google Cloud 控制台,依序點選「導覽選單」>「Vertex AI」>「Workbench」

  2. 在「使用者自行管理的 Notebooks」頁面,點選「建立新的」並選取「TensorFlow 企業版 2.12 (Intel® MKL-DNN/MKL)」

  3. 請使用預設可用區和區域: 。 其他設定維持不變,然後點選「建立」。新的 VM 會在 2 到 3 分鐘內啟用。

  4. 點選「Open JupyterLab」。 JupyterLab 視窗會在新分頁中開啟。

點選「Check my progress」確認目標已達成。 建立 Vertex AI Workbench 執行個體

工作 2:複製 Vertex AI Workbench 執行個體中的課程存放區

如要複製 JupyterLab 執行個體中的筆記本,請按照下列步驟操作:

  1. 在 JupyterLab 中,開啟新的終端機視窗。

  2. 在指令列提示中執行下列指令:

git clone https://github.com/GoogleCloudPlatform/asl-ml-immersion.git cd asl-ml-immersion export PATH=$PATH:~/.local/bin make install
  1. 如要確認是否已複製存放區,請按兩下 asl-ml-immersion 目錄,確認可以查看內容。 此課程會用到的所有 Jupyter 筆記本研究室檔案,都放在這個目錄。

點選「Check my progress」確認目標已達成。 複製 Vertex AI 平台 Notebooks 執行個體中的課程存放區

工作 3:透過 Gemini API 採取保護措施

  1. 在筆記本介面中,依序前往「asl-ml-immersion」>「notebooks」>「responsible_ai」>「safety」>「solutions」,然後開啟「gemini_safety_ratings.ipynb」

  2. 在筆記本介面中,依序點選「編輯」>「清除所有輸出內容」

  3. 詳閱筆記本操作說明,然後執行筆記本中的所有內容。

提示:如要執行目前的儲存格,請點選儲存格,然後按下 Shift + Enter 鍵。如需其他儲存格指令,請查看筆記本 UI 中的「Run」部分。

關閉研究室

如果您已完成研究室,請按一下「End Lab」(關閉研究室)。Qwiklabs 會移除您已用的資源,並清除使用帳戶。

您可以為研究室的使用體驗評分。請選取合適的星級評等並提供意見,然後按一下「Submit」(提交)

星級評等代表您的滿意程度:

  • 1 星 = 非常不滿意
  • 2 星 = 不滿意
  • 3 星 = 普通
  • 4 星 = 滿意
  • 5 星 = 非常滿意

如果不想提供意見回饋,您可以直接關閉對話方塊。

如有任何想法、建議或指教,請透過「Support」(支援) 分頁提交。

Copyright 2022 Google LLC 保留所有權利。Google 和 Google 標誌是 Google LLC 的商標,其他公司和產品名稱則有可能是其關聯公司的商標。